SANTA CRUZ, JAVIER  and  CORDERO, SEBASTIÁN. First Record Ofaraujia Sericifera (Apocynaceae: Asclepiadoideae) For Chile, A New Alien Climbing Species From South America. Bol. Soc. Argent. Bot. [online]. 2018, vol.53, n.2, pp.1-10. ISSN 1851-2372.

The presence of Araujia sericifera Brot. (Apocynaceae) in the vascular fora of central Chile is reported for the frst time. A morphological description and an illustration is provided, as well as a background about its habitat, ecology and phenology.
